Remediation
With its experience in building renovation projects,
as designers, building contractors, and project managers, Hunarch
Consulting offers considerable expertise in identifying remediation
requirements, and for designing and managing remediation programs.

Experience of firm
The principal of Hunarch, Rod Hunter is
an architect with twenty-five years of professional experience.
Architectural projects upon which Rod
Hunter has been engaged include:
- Supported accommodation facility, Thornbury
- Residential facilities, Sutherland Homes for Children, Greensborough
- Residential facility: E.W. Tipping
Foundation (cost advice to Department of Human Services)
- Day Centre Facility, Disability Attendant Care Support Service
- Day Centre Facility, Burke and Beyond/Interchange
(day care facility for children and youths with intellectual disability)
- Special developmental schools (design
brief project for Victorian Public Works Department)
- Pre-school centre, Dandenong
- Fitness and sports centre, Thornbury
- Office development, Glen Waverly
- Motel/conference centre development, Mount Waverly
- Motel/golf club development, Keysborough
- Commercial showrooms, Lilydale
- Design advice, Multiple Sclerosis Society, Footscray.
- Residential projects, including house
renovations.
